The Plat, to be known as LONG LAKE LANDING, will <br />facilitate development of the APi headquarters, a secondary multi-tenant office building, public improvements <br />already constructed, and various lots and outlots for future residential development. The plat will create 3 lots <br />and 6 out lot’s, on two blocks including dedicated right-of-way named Northwest Parkway and Central Park <br />Boulevard. <br /> <br />Zisla inquired if park dedication is required on this property. Gundlach replied that while park dedication <br />would normally be paid at this time, the City is platting the property and so no fee will be collected as the City <br />could just be paying itself. Additionally, land is being dedicated for parkland with this plat. Park dedication <br />fees have already been negotiated with the housing developers and APi has resolved their park dedication <br />within their contract. Zisla stated that it is inconsistent, since if it were a private developer they would have to <br />pay the park dedication fee. Fernelius asked Zisla to clarify the inconsistency. Zisla replied that there is a <br />requirement when land is subdivided that park dedication is required. Fernelius stated that under the <br />agreements with the developers they have agreed to pay the park dedication. He added that the mechanics are a <br />little awkward when the City is the sub-divider. Staff has talked with the City Attorney about this and as a <br />practical matter the City has negotiated with the developers to have those fees paid. Zisla inquired if the <br />developer pulls out of the development what would happen. Fernelius replied that the fees would not get paid, <br />but they would be built into any future development. Zisla replied that is how it should have been handled from <br />the beginning.
